Critical Inquiry Workflow Router (ci-workflow)

The orchestrator for a Critical Inquiry submission. Figure out the stage and the format, then

send the user to the matching skill. CI is interdisciplinary criticism and theory — not a single

discipline's house organ — so the router's first job is to make sure the essay is built around a

theoretical intervention that matters across fields, not a competent reading with no stakes.

When to trigger

  • Starting a new CI essay and unsure where to begin
  • Mid-project and unsure which skill applies next
  • Deciding among the three formats (Article, Critical Response, Review)
  • Returning with a decision letter (route to ci-revision-and-response)

First question: which format?

| Situation | Format | Route to |

|-----------|--------|----------|

| Full original argument, interdisciplinary stakes | Article (≤ 9,500 words) | normal pipeline below |

| Reply to or debate with a published CI piece | Critical Response (≤ 3,000 words) | ci-argument-and-intervention + ci-scholarly-positioning |

| Short notice of a book/exhibition | Review (≤ 500 words) | ci-writing-style + ci-submission |

| A themed cluster of essays | Special issue (editor-proposed) | ci-review-process (proposal route) |

> The 9,500-word article cap includes discursive notes and all bibliographical information — plan

> the notes into the budget from the start (see ci-writing-style).

Symptom → route (when the stage is unclear)

| Symptom in the draft | Actual problem | Route to |

|----------------------|----------------|----------|

| Sentences polished, paragraphs still reorderable | Structure, not prose | ci-structure-and-exposition |

| Readers praise the readings yet ask "so what?" | No intervention yet | ci-argument-and-intervention |

| Theory citations pile up while the claim stalls | Theory as décor | ci-theory-and-method |

| Claim sounds right; nothing on the page earns it | Objects not testing it | ci-evidence-and-objects |

| Word count blown though the body reads lean | Notes eating the cap | ci-citation-and-style |

| Confident essay; only one subfield would care | Fit and framing | ci-topic-selection |

Two routing mistakes to catch early

  • Format drift. A Critical Response swelling past ~3,000 words is usually an Article trying to

happen — reroute it into the full pipeline; an "Article" whose real content is a quarrel with one

published CI piece should shrink into a Response.

  • Late-stage gatekeeping. Author-secured permissions, 300 ppi image files, and Chicago-note

discipline are pipeline stages, not submission-day chores; route image-heavy essays through

ci-citation-and-style early — rights can outlast a decision.

Anti-patterns

  • Treating CI like a single-discipline journal — the intervention must travel across fields
  • A survey or literature review with no claim of its own (CI wants an intervention, not a digest)
  • Theory used as decoration rather than as an instrument that does work on an object
  • Skipping image permissions and Chicago-note discipline until the end
